Sentence examples for affection to keep from inspiring English sources

The phrase "affection to keep" is not correct and does not convey a clear meaning in written English.
It may be intended to express a desire to maintain or hold onto affection, but the wording is awkward and unclear.
Example: "She had a deep affection to keep, but it was difficult to hold onto it in such a challenging situation."
Alternatives: "affection to maintain" or "love to preserve".
